USMTS Rules Announced for the 2015 Race Season


WEBSTER CITY, Iowa -- Rules for the 2015 United States Modified Touring Series are complete, officials from the United States Modified Touring Series announced today.

Once again we at USMTS understand that with change comes cost and we want to keep as few changes as possible. There was some grey areas that still need covered and drivers, crewmembers really need to read the rules to make sure you are within the rulebook. Drivers are always looking for that little extra edge and sometimes it may not be written in the rules so be sure to check out the 2015 rules.

The suspension area was updated as USMTS has went to pull bar or lift arm only. No cantilever bars will be allowed in 2015, another change will be the spoilers have been reduced to five inches for the USMTS Spec headed cars and three inches for the open competitor cars. Frames will be a concern and drivers and owners need to be checking with USRA/USMTS tech officials about what will be allowed in this area. We have heard lots of grumblings about this already and cheated up frames will not be tolerated. USMTS has also added in the concept engine that will get a 50# weight break. Another area that seen a minor change was the weight rule 50# of weight was added to each option.

Rules are on the USMTS website and available for download as is the 2015 USMTS license application and will be available at the trade show in Mesquite, TX this weekend.
